Scallop Shell Definition . Scallop shells are easily recognized and have been a symbol since ancient times. The shell of a scallop consists of two parts, typically in a fan shape with a hinge and two wings on either side. Like clams and oysters, scallops are bivalves — mollusks that have a shell with two. These shells can be rough or smooth and often wash up. The meaning of scallop is any of numerous marine bivalve lamellibranch mollusks (family pectinidae) that have a radially ribbed shell with the edge undulated and that swim by.
